What Florida Building Code Cares About Most Florida Building Code window replacement rules are mostly about safety, wind performance, and keeping the home envelope intact. That means the code is not just checking whether the window opens and closes. It is looking at how the unit is tested, approved, installed, and anchored. Product approval is usually the first box to check. Florida product approval impact windows are widely used here because they have been tested for wind and debris resistance. Some shoppers also compare Miami-Dade NOA rated windows Oviedo FL when they want a product with especially rigorous approval documentation. A good product does not rescue a bad install. Wrong fasteners, poor shimming, and sloppy flashing can undo the benefits of a quality unit, which is why licensed window installers Seminole County FL are worth insisting on. Material choice matters too. Vinyl vs aluminum windows Florida homes is not just a style debate. Vinyl often offers better thermal performance, while aluminum can be stronger and slimmer in profile, especially in certain impact-rated assemblies. The right answer depends on exposure, budget, and the look you want on the house. Homeowners also ask about impact windows vs regular windows Florida. The short version is that regular windows may be fine in low-risk settings, but impact units add storm protection, noise reduction, UV protection, and often a stronger insurance conversation. Costs, Permits, And Real-World Trade-Offs How much does window replacement cost in Oviedo FL varies with the opening, the product line, and the installation method. In most markets, pocket replacement is less expensive because more of the existing frame stays in place, while full frame replacement adds labor and materials. The most common window installation mistakes to avoid are usually the unglamorous ones, bad flashing, sloppy measurements, the wrong fasteners, or a product that was ordered without matching the actual opening. Those mistakes tend to show up later as leaks, drafts, and warranty trouble. Older homes often show the issue before the window fully fails. Drafts, condensation, soft sills, hard-to-move sashes, and corrosion around the frame are common signs you need new windows Oviedo FL and also signs your windows are failing Florida humidity. One of the main budget forks is full frame vs pocket window replacement. A pocket installation can be quicker and less invasive when the existing frame is solid, while full frame replacement is the better fix when rot, leaks, or out-of-square openings are behind the trim. That is why signs your windows are failing Florida humidity should be taken seriously before the project starts, not after the installer opens the wall. Common warning signs include fogging between panes, decayed frames, hard-to-open sashes, and persistent drafts that do not improve with minor fixes. Window condensation problems Florida homes often point to seal failure, frame wear, or ventilation issues that should not be ignored.
